Resumen

The purpose of this Act is to ensure the financing of the Ontario Corn Producers’ Association to enable it to promote the production of corn and improve its marketing by: a) encouraging and improving all phases of corn production and marketing; b) co-operating with government and governmental agencies; c) holding meetings to consider related issues; d) co-operating with agricultural associations of producers ; e) collecting, arranging, assembling and disseminating information; and f) making representations at all levels. Every person who sells grain or corn shall be deemed to be the holder of a licence, except in case of default in payment of licence fees. Section 6 sets out the regulations that the Lieutenant Governor in Council may make, such as fixing the amount of licence fees, etc. The text consists of 7 sections.
